Right i think iv got my head round this now i would of replied last night but my head was well and truly up my **** and would have been wrong lol. It looks to me that you have a front mount intercooler fitted so the pipes are fitted a different way to standard. I think what you mean by the pcv valve is actually the diverter valve which sits in the intake pipe which has a pipe off the metal charge pipe going to it and a small vacuum pipe on top of it. As for the crossbox you are right thats the n75 valve which controls boost hence the pipe going to the actuator it also sits in the intake pipe it has an electrical connection and has another pipe which is a vacuum feed. The only thing i can think of what you mean is the pressure regulating valve which is a ufo shaped thing in the intake pipe the rest of it goes to the crankcase breathers and from the pic thats in the right place. I cant think of anything which is ball shaped nothing on my car like that tbh.
 
There is alot to remember though to be fair lol. If you take your n75 out there are 3 pipes 1 is longer than the other 2. The longest one goes into the intake pipe the one above to the actuator and the one on the side to the compressor on the turbo i cant tell if its right from the pic. The other pipe you have is for the charcoal canister which is by the power steering fluid resevoir the plastic thing is a one way check valve and that does look like its the right way.
